Abstract | Education Consolidation and Improvement Act (ECIA) Chapter 2 Formula has provided funding to the Austin (Texas) Independent School District (AISD) in order to expand existing programs and implement new programs, including the addition of staff and the acquisition of materials and equipment that would not otherwise be available from state or local funding sources. Continued funding will allow the District to provide programs that meet the educational needs of at risk students, provide for the acquisition and use of educational materials, provide training for District personnel, provide programs to enhance the personal excellence of students and student achievement, and provide for other innovative projects, such as early childhood education programs. In 1991-92, Chapter 2 Formula funds were allocated for 15 programs, which are described in some detail in this report: (1) Academic Decathlon; (2) Bridge Computer Lab at Read Elementary; (3) Wicat Computer Lab at Blanton Elementary; (4) Writing to Read Computer Lab at Blackshear Elementary; (5) Extracurricular Transportation; (6) Library Resources; (7) Middle School Homeroom Training; (8) Multicultural/Special Purpose Buses; (9) Prekindergarten Supplements; (10) Secondary Library Technology Support; (11) Spanish Academy; (12) Support for Restructured Robbins Secondary School; (13) Technology Learning Center; (14) Private Schools; (15) Administration/management; and (16) Evaluation. The description of each of these programs includes a summary of its effectiveness based on a districtwide employee survey. An executive summary of the report is also provided.
